Background
With the development of urban modernization, high-rise buildings are more and more, and elevators have become indispensable tools in the production and life of people. The elevator is a vertical elevator taking a motor as power, is used for passengers or cargo carrying of a multi-storey building, and in the existing elevator, the emergency rescue modes mainly comprise two types: in order to rescue by adopting the safety window, the pedal is fixed on the back wall of the lift car to replace a cat ladder, the condition that the rescue effect is difficult to achieve possibly occurs in the actual use process, the pedal arranged on the lift car wall affects the attractiveness of the lift car on one hand, and then the pedal is difficult to play a role in the use process, the trapped person can save oneself by means of the pedal in the climbing process, the upper part is not in a force-borrowing place, and the safety window is difficult to climb up through the pedal arranged on the rear upper part of the body; the second is to set up an emergency rescue door on the car enclosure wall, the design of the emergency rescue door is quite complex, and safety risks exist, if the emergency rescue door lock fails or is damaged, passengers in the car may directly fall into the hoistway from the emergency rescue door, and danger occurs. If the scheme is not provided, when people are trapped, firefighters may be required to break and detach the elevator car in order to rescue the trapped people as soon as possible, the elevator structure is damaged by such rescue, the elevator cannot be recovered after rescue, the existing elevator structure is inconvenient for people to evacuate when a safety accident occurs, and therefore the elevator structure with the escape top is provided.

Detailed Description
The following description of the embodiments of the present utility model will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present utility model, but not all embodiments. All other embodiments, which can be made by those skilled in the art based on the embodiments of the utility model without making any inventive effort, are intended to be within the scope of the utility model.
Referring to fig. 1-8, an elevator structure with escape at the top comprises a placement panel 1, a rescue ladder 10 and a car roof 7, wherein a bump 5 is arranged at the back of the placement panel 1, a hole is arranged on the bump 5, the rescue ladder 10 is fixed at the back of the placement panel 1 through a fixing device 9, the fixing device 9 comprises a knob 901, a threaded rod 902 and a clamping plate 903, the bottom of the knob 901 is fixedly connected with the top of the threaded rod 902, the bottom of the threaded rod 902 is fixedly connected with the top of the clamping plate 903, the rescue ladder 10 consists of a first ladder 101 and a second ladder 102, the second ladder 102 is positioned at the top of the first ladder 101, the second ladder 102 is fixed with the first ladder 101 through a clamping device 11, the clamping device 11 comprises a handle 1101, a spring 1102 and a movable rod 1103, the bottom of the handle 1101 is fixedly connected with the top of the movable rod 1103, the top of the spring 1102 is fixedly connected with the bottom of the handle 1101, a handle 3 is arranged on the surface of the placement panel 1, the placement panel 1 is movably connected with the car roof 7 through a hinge 2, a groove 8 is arranged on the car roof 7, trapezoidal bump 6 is arranged at the top and the bottom of the groove 8, the ladder 101 is fixedly connected with the top of the clamping plate 101, the first ladder is fixedly provided with a slide bar is provided with a slide bar 4, and a slide bar is provided with a slide bar 12, and a slide bar is provided at the right side is provided with a slide bar 13.
When the rescue ladder is used, when a safety accident occurs, the handle 3 is pulled to enable the placement panel 1 to rotate and open, the knob 901 is rotated to enable the threaded rod 902 to move in the direction away from the rescue ladder 10, the rescue ladder 10 is taken down, the handle 1101 is pulled to enable the movable rod 1103 to be separated from a hole on the second ladder 102, and the rescue ladder 10 is unfolded by pulling the second ladder 102 to enable the rescue ladder 10 to be placed well, so that the rescue ladder can climb out along the rescue ladder.
